Step 1: Initial Inspection and Moisture Assessment

We begin with a detailed inspection of your property to locate all affected areas and identify the moisture source. Using infrared cameras and moisture meters, we pinpoint hidden dampness, which is crucial for effective mold remediation. This assessment typically takes a few hours, depending on the property’s size. We’re looking for hidden moisture sources and visible mold growth.

Step 2: Containment of the Moldy Area

To prevent the spread of mold spores, we set up containment barriers. This involves sealing off the affected area with plastic sheeting and negative air pressure machines. This crucial step ensures that mold doesn’t travel to other parts of your home during the remediation process. We create a safe containment zone for your protection. This step helps maintain clean air quality.

Step 3: Mold Removal and Cleaning

Our trained technicians carefully remove mold-infested materials. This can include drywall, insulation, or carpeting. We use specialized cleaning solutions and HEPA-filtered vacuums to remove mold from surfaces. For non-porous materials, we clean and disinfect them thoroughly. We handle safe mold removal with care. Our goal is complete surface cleaning.

Step 4: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the mold is removed, we focus on thoroughly drying the affected area. We use industrial-grade air movers and dehumidifiers to reduce moisture levels below 60%. This step is vital to prevent new mold growth. We monitor humidity closely throughout this phase. Rapid drying techniques are key. We ensure long-term moisture control.

Step 5: Air Filtration and Clearance

Finally, we use air scrubbers with HEPA filters to remove any remaining airborne mold spores. We continue to monitor air quality until it returns to normal pre-loss conditions. Warning Signs You Need Mold Remediation Services

Catching mold early is essential. The longer mold grows, the more damage it can cause and the more extensive the remediation will be. Recognizing these common warning signs can save you significant time and money. Pay attention to what your home is telling you. Early mold detection is critical. Ignoring these signs can lead to serious structural damage.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ent, musty smell, especially in damp areas like basements or bathrooms, is a strong indicator of mold growth. If the smell lingers even after cleaning, mold is likely present behind walls or under flooring. Persistent musty smells shouldn’t be ignored. This odor often signals hidden mold colonies.

Visible Mold Growth

Any visible patches of mold, whether black, green, white, or orange, are a clear sign that you need professional help. Mold can appear fuzzy, slimy, or powdery. Don’t try to clean large areas yourself. Visible mold spots require immediate attention. We address all mold appearances.

Water Damage or Leaks

Areas that have experienced water damage, such as from a leaky pipe, roof leak, or flooding, are prime breeding grounds for mold. Even if the water is gone, residual moisture can fuel mold growth for weeks or months. Past water damage is a mold risk. We inspect all flood-affected areas.

Discoloration on Walls or Ceilings

St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ings, particularly those that appear suddenly or spread, can indicate moisture behind the surface, leading to mold. These spots often appear as brown, black, or yellow splotches. Unexplained wall stains are a warning. We look for discoloration issues.

Peeling or Bubbling Paint/Wallpaper

Moisture trapped behind paint or wallpaper can cause it to peel, bubble, or blister. This is often a sign that mold is growing underneath the surface. This damage points to underlying moisture problems. We investigate surface material damage.

Mold Remediation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small spot of surface mold (less than 1 sq ft) on a non-porous surface. Yes, with caution. No. You can often clean small, surface mold yourself using appropriate cleaners and protective gear.
Mold growth covering a larger area (more than 3 sq ft). No. Yes. Larger infestations require professional containment and specialized equipment to ensure safe and complete removal.
Mold in HVAC systems or air ducts. No. Yes. Mold in ventilation systems can quickly spread spores throughout your entire home.
Mold suspected behind walls, under carpets, or in insulation. No. Yes. These hidden areas require specialized tools and expertise to locate, remove, and dry properly.
Mold growth after significant water damage (flooding, burst pipe). No. Yes. Extensive water damage means widespread moisture and potential for deep mold penetration, needing professional drying and remediation.
Any mold growth accompanied by health concerns or allergies. No. Yes. Health risks are too high; professionals can ensure thorough removal and air quality restoration.

For any mold situation beyond a tiny surface spot, especially if it’s in hidden areas or caused by significant water issues, calling a professional is the safest and most effective route. Mold Remediation Services Cost In Clarkston, GA

The cost for mold remediation services in Clarkston, GA can vary widely. Factors like the size of the affected area, the type of materials contaminated, and the extent of moisture damage all play a role. These figures are estimates for the local area. Accurate mold remediation costs depend on an on-site assessment. We offer transparent pricing estimates.

Service Aspect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Mold Inspection and Assessment $300 – $800 Size of property, complexity of moisture source identification.
Containment Setup (per area) $500 – $1,500 Size of area, need for negative air pressure.
Mold Removal (porous materials like drywall, carpet) $1,000 – $5,000+ Square footage of affected materials, difficulty of access.
Mold Cleaning (non-porous surfaces) $500 – $2,000 Surface area needing cleaning, type of cleaning agents required.
Drying and Dehumidification $700 – $3,000 Duration of drying needed, size of affected space.
Air Filtration and Clearance Testing $500 – $1,500 Number of air scrubbers used, need for independent lab testing.

Will my homeowner’s insurance cover mold remediation?

Coverage varies by policy. Most policies cover mold damage if it’s caused by a sudden, accidental event like a burst pipe or storm damage, but not if it’s due to long-term neglect or poor maintenance. How can I prevent mold from returning after remediation?

Prevention is key. Controlling indoor humidity levels below 60% is crucial, often achieved with dehumidifiers and good ventilation. Fixing any leaks promptly and ensuring proper airflow in damp areas like bathrooms and kitchens will also help. We can advise on long-term mold prevention. We offer moisture control strategies.
